On June 14th we invite you to join us for an informal social that celebrates creativity in Jedburgh.
There are two ways to get involved!
One; for all you makers out there, we ask you to bring along something to show. It could be a painting, a poem, a loaf of bread, a scarf, a birdhouse, an arrangement of flowers, a record, and book… you get the idea. Anything goes! And we’re not looking just for ‘professional’ creatives. If you made it and you live in (or near enough!) to Jed, bring it on down.
We’ll set up a mini, pop up exhibition where people can see you work. Just bring something along and we’ll do the rest.
Two: you might be a creative person. But you might love creativity! So come on down and see what people in your community are up to.
Anything else?
Sure. It’s a chance to speak to other people who love a bit of creativity and making. It’s a chance to speak to us (Jedburgh Community Arts) about our work and the Town Hall project. And there’ll be colouring and lego building stations too.
We’re getting together in The Carter’s Rest on June 14th from 12pm – 2pm. If the sun is out, the beer garden and kids playground are just outside. We’d love to see you there!
